Fog forces Brighton trip to be abandoned

Fog on the Island last night (Sunday) ruined plans by the Manx Government to be represented at the annual Labour Party Conference.

Island officials were hoping to discuss Brexit with Labour party delegates in Brighton.

Chief Minister Howard Quayle and Policy and Reform Minister Chris Thomas had been due to fly to Gatwick last night (Sunday) but the plane was unable to land at Ronaldsway and so returned to London.

It is hoped the Island will be represented at the Conservative Party Conference in Manchester next week.
